Color Coordination: Tips on matching red shoes with a navy blue dress for a cohesive look

To create a cohesive look with red shoes and a navy blue dress, it's essential to consider the color wheel and complementary hues. Red and navy blue are both bold colors that can work well together when balanced correctly. One tip is to introduce a neutral element, such as a beige or light gray handbag, to soften the contrast and tie the outfit together. Additionally, incorporating a red accessory, like a scarf or belt, can help bridge the gap between the shoes and the dress, creating a more harmonious ensemble.

Another approach is to play with patterns and textures. For instance, if your dress has a subtle pattern, choose shoes with a similar pattern or texture to create visual interest without overwhelming the outfit. Alternatively, if your dress is solid navy blue, opt for red shoes with a unique texture, like suede or velvet, to add depth and dimension to the look. Remember, the key is to find a balance between the two colors and to ensure that neither the shoes nor the dress overpower the other.

When it comes to the specific shade of red, consider the undertones of your navy blue dress. If the dress has a cooler undertone, a blue-based red, such as a burgundy or a deep crimson, will complement it well. On the other hand, if the dress has a warmer undertone, a yellow-based red, like a bright cherry or a tomato red, can create a striking contrast. Experiment with different shades and see what works best for your particular dress.

Lastly, don't forget about the occasion and the overall style you're aiming for. If you're dressing for a formal event, a classic pump or a sleek flat in a solid red can elevate the look. For a more casual setting, a strappy sandal or a playful loafer in a patterned red can add a fun and relaxed touch. By considering the context and the desired style, you can create a cohesive and fashionable outfit that perfectly matches your red shoes with your navy blue dress.

Occasion Suitability: Guidance on when it's appropriate to wear red shoes with a navy blue dress

Red shoes can be a bold and eye-catching accessory, but pairing them with a navy blue dress requires careful consideration of the occasion. For formal events, such as weddings or business functions, it's generally best to opt for more conservative footwear in a neutral color like black, beige, or navy to maintain a polished and professional appearance. However, if you're attending a more casual or creative event, such as an art gallery opening or a dinner party, red shoes can be a fun and stylish choice that adds a pop of color to your outfit.

When deciding whether to wear red shoes with a navy blue dress, it's also important to consider the overall color scheme of your ensemble. If your dress has red accents or details, such as a red belt or red embroidery, then red shoes can be a cohesive and intentional choice that ties the whole look together. On the other hand, if your dress is a solid navy blue without any red elements, then red shoes may clash and create a disjointed appearance.

Another factor to consider is the style of your red shoes. If you're wearing a more conservative dress, such as a knee-length or long-sleeved navy blue dress, then it's best to choose red shoes with a lower heel and a more classic design. This will help to balance the boldness of the red color with the more subdued style of the dress. However, if you're wearing a shorter or more revealing dress, such as a mini skirt or a sleeveless dress, then you can be more daring with your shoe choice and opt for a higher heel or a more unique design.

Ultimately, the decision of whether to wear red shoes with a navy blue dress comes down to personal style and the specific occasion. By considering the formality of the event, the overall color scheme of your outfit, and the style of your shoes, you can make an informed decision that ensures you look and feel your best.
